WebThus, cannabis use may also be an attempt at self-medicating—that is, “chasing dopamine.” In addition, studies show that cannabis use (in particular, early-onset use and ongoing use) and ADHD are both associated with deficits in neurocognition, including attention, memory, and executive functions.
